CRYSTAL STRUCTURE OF HUMAN PHOSPHOINOSITIDE-DEPENDENT PROTEIN KINASE 1 (PDK1) 3-{5-[2-Oxo-5-ureido-1,2-dihydro-indol-(3Z)-ylidenemethyl]-1H-pyrrol-3-yl}-N-(2-piperidin-1-yl-ethyl)-benzamide COMPLEX
Overview
Based on the lead compound BX-517, a series of C-4' substituted indolinones have been synthesized and evaluated for PDK1 inhibition. Modification at C-4' of the pyrrole afforded potent compounds (7b and 7d) with improved solubility and ADME properties. In this letter, we describe the synthesis, selectivity profile, and pharmacokinetic data of selected compounds.
